Transaction 32ed26ee586753631f5957275570a9378e77161e34eff158ab405933e697dfc3
1 Input
1 Output
-
32ed26ee586753631f5957275570a9378e77161e34eff158ab405933e697dfc3:0
- value
- 33390
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 c2f9597179255e2855ab95c93f8227a457fdc9265891e0cff22eccd08efc0186
- address
- bc1pctu4jutey40zs4dtjhynlq3853tlmjfxtzg7pnlj9mxdprhuqxrq3dg2z3